本文将带领读者进入沭阳ios软件平台的世界,深入探索苹果系统开发的秘诀。从ios概述、开发工具、编程语言、UI设计和测试调试等多个方面,详细介绍如何开发高质量的ios应用程序。本文旨在帮助开发者更好地了解ios应用开发,提高开发效率,实现更好的用户体验。
1. 理解ios的基础知识
首先,我们需要了解ios系统的概念和特点。ios系统是苹果公司开发的移动操作系统,主要适用于iphone、ipad、ipod等设备。ios系统具有安全性高、用户体验好、运行稳定等优点,不仅支持基本应用程序,还能够运行复杂的应用程序。因此,ios应用开发者需要深入了解ios的特点和应用环境,才能够开发出高质量的ios应用程序。
2. 熟练掌握ios开发工具
熟练使用ios开发工具是开发者必备的技能之一。常用的ios开发工具包括Xcode、Instruments、Interface Builder、Version Editor、Source Control等。其中,Xcode是ios开发中最为重要的工具之一,可以用于编辑、编译和测试代码。在使用ios开发工具时,开发者需要了解工具的功能和使用方法,根据实际需要进行选择和调整,才能够提高开发效率。
3. 掌握ios编程语言
掌握ios编程语言是ios应用开发的基础,常用的编程语言包括Objective-C、Swift。Objective-C是ios开发中最常用的编程语言,具有较好的编程效率和稳定性;Swift是苹果公司于2014年发布的新型编程语言,在开发效率和代码安全性上有更大的优势。开发者需要根据实际需求选择合适的编程语言,并掌握编程语言的规范和基础概念,才能够编写出高效、可靠的应用程序。
4. 设计精美的UI界面
UI设计是ios应用开发中不可忽视的一部分,具有直接影响用户体验和应用质量的重要性。开发者需要根据应用的特性和用户需求,设计精美的UI界面,并保证在不同设备上的统一性和流畅性。常用的UI设计工具包括Photoshop、Sketch、Adobe Illustrator等,开发者需要掌握这些工具,并根据实际应用需求进行UI设计和优化。
5. 测试调试应用程序
测试调试是ios应用开发中不可或缺的一环,其质量直接关系到应用的稳定性和用户体验。开发者需要根据应用的特性和需求,选择不同的测试方法和工具,进行测试和调试。常用的测试工具包括Xcode内置的测试功能、Instruments、LLDB等。在测试和调试过程中,开发者需要充分运用工具和技巧,尽快发现并解决问题,保证应用程序的质量。
本文详细介绍了沭阳ios软件平台的开发技巧和秘诀,从ios概述、开发工具、编程语言、UI设计和测试调试等多个方面进行了详细介绍。希望开发者们能够根据本文内容,更好地了解和掌握ios应用开发的技术和方法,实现更好的用户体验和更高的开发效率。
本文将从多个角度深入探索苹果系统开发的秘诀,着重介绍沭阳ios软件平台的教程。通过对苹果系统开发的了解和学习,可以帮助读者更好地掌握这个领域的知识,在实际开发中提高效率和质量。
1. iOS开发环境的搭建和工具的介绍
苹果公司提供了一套完整的开发工具,包括Xcode、iOS SDK、iOS模拟器等。本节将介绍如何正确地安装和配置这些工具,并介绍它们的作用和特点。
2. iOS开发语言和框架的介绍
iOS开发使用的主要语言是Objective-C和Swift,本节将分别介绍这两种语言的特点和应用场景,同时还会介绍各种开发框架,包括UI框架、数据存储框架以及网络请求框架等。
3. iOS开发中的一些基本知识和技术
本节将涵盖一些iOS开发中的基本知识和技术,包括视图布局、手势识别、动画、多线程、HTTP/HTTPS网络协议等。这些知识点虽然不是最高级的,但是对于初学者来说很重要。
4. iOS应用的开发与发布
本节将教授如何使用Xcode开发iOS应用,并介绍打包和发布应用的流程。还会分享一些关于应用审核和上架的经验和技巧。
5. iOS开发的未来趋势和发展方向
本节将分享有关iOS开发的未来趋势和发展方向的一些看法和理解,帮助读者在学习和实践中不断拓展自己的眼界和思路。
本文涉及的内容虽然只是苹果系统开发的冰山一角,但对于初学者来说已经足够了。通过深度学习和实践,相信读者可以很快地从初学者到入门者,再到高级开发人员。同时也希望读者不断钻研,不断拓展自己的知识面和技术水平,为自己的职业生涯和行业发展做出更大的贡献。